📚About the Program
Chengdu University (CDU), founded in 1978 and located in the picturesque Shiling Historical and Cultural Scenic Area of Chengdu, China, is a comprehensive higher education institution renowned for its commitment to quality education. With over 30,000 students and 1,600 staff members, CDU offers a diverse range of programs across various fields, fostering a student-oriented environment that emphasizes the development of competent and professional graduates.
The Master’s in Food Testing at CDU is a three-year program designed to equip students with advanced skills in applying biology, chemistry, and engineering to food processing and packaging. The curriculum focuses on innovative techniques for ensuring food safety and quality, preparing graduates for careers in the food industry, regulatory agencies, and research institutions. This program's unique blend of scientific principles and practical applications positions students to meet the growing demand for food safety experts in a rapidly evolving market.
